Introduction to Marina Bay Sands

Marina Bay Sands in Singapore is a global architectural icon, renowned for its three towering structures crowned by an expansive sky park. Opened in 2010, it remains a masterpiece in 2025, blending luxury, innovation, and sustainability. Designed by Moshe Safdie, this integrated resort combines a hotel, casino, retail, and entertainment spaces, transforming Singapore’s skyline. Its 2,561-room hotel, sprawling convention center, and iconic infinity pool draw millions annually, making it a cornerstone of urban tourism.

Architectural Concept of Marina Bay Sands

The architectural concept of Marina Bay Sands revolves around creating a vertical urban ecosystem that integrates luxury, leisure, and sustainability. Envisioned as a microcosm of a city, it connects three 55-story towers with a sky park, fostering interaction across diverse functions like hospitality, retail, and entertainment. In 2025, this concept remains revolutionary, emphasizing connectivity and environmental harmony within Singapore’s dense urban fabric.

Architectural design aligns the towers in a curved formation, optimizing views of Marina Bay. Design features include a sky park with gardens and an infinity pool, creating a communal oasis at 200 meters.
